      Garfield was killed by Charles Guiteau, a “Stalwart Republican” who “believed he, the Republican Party, and the country had been betrayed and that God repeatedly told him that he could save the party and the nation if President Garfield was ‘removed’.”

      I suspect your friend is confusing Garfield with McKinley. McKinley was killed by Anarchist Leon Czolgosz (not a Democrat).

      Kennedy was killed by die-hard Stalinist Lee Harvey Oswald (not a Democrat).

      Ford’s would be assassins were Lynette Fromme, a member of The Manson Family, and Sarah Jane Moore, a sympathizer of The Symbionese Liberation Army (neither group being Democrats). In fact, other than kidnapping Patty Hearst, the SLA was best known for the assassination of Oakland school superintendent Marcus Foster, a liberal Democrat.

      I think you’re right. As I understand, subpoenas have been issued for witnesses to come before the federal grand jury. When they meet is not disclosed. If the federal grand jury indicts, the indictment is sealed and the U.S.Attorney contacts the accused to let them know that the federal grand jury’s decision. They then discuss plea bargains. It is up to the accused to obtain their own legal counsel because at that point, they are not arrested.

      If the accused does not agree with a plea bargain, the U.S. Attorney then unseals the charge, a warrant is issued, and the accused arrested. If they cannot afford an attorney, the feds will appoint one.

      I’ve known of cases in the federal system where the accused has gone back and forth with the U.S. Attorney’s office for six months before the indictment was unsealed.
